Parliament approved an Anti-LGBTQ+ bill aiming to outlaw the actions of homosexuals.
Yet, President Akufo-Addo has not yet approved the bill, delaying its enactment.
This has sparked various discussions and debates among the public.
While some Ghanaians eagerly await the president’s endorsement of the bill, others argue that the penalties outlined in it are cruel and warrant reconsideration.
